Southwire type TFN conductors may be used as fixture wire and as permitted for fire protective signal circuits as specified in the National Electrical Code® at conductor temperatures not to exceed 90 deg C or 105 deg C when used as AWM |
Voltage rating for all applications is 600 volts |
15 mil insulation thickness |
4 mil jacket thickness |
Thermoplastic insulation/nylon sheath heat, moisture, oil, and gasoline resistant |
